Prerequisites
Devices configured to send traps
The devices must be configured to send SNMP traps or INFORMs to the Netdata Agent acting as the site's trap receiver, and the trap port must be reachable from them.
A usable Netdata log directory
Jobs that write direct journals store them under ${NETDATA_LOG_DIR}/traps/ — /var/log/netdata on package installs, /opt/netdata/var/log/netdata on static ones. Job creation fails if that directory is missing or unwritable. A job that only exports over OTLP can set journal.enabled: false instead.
Permission to bind the trap port
The default listener is UDP/162, a privileged port: binding it needs CAP_NET_BIND_SERVICE or root on Linux. Netdata packages grant this capability, so standard installations just work; hardened or custom deployments must grant it, or move the listener to an unprivileged port.

Examples
Basic (SNMPv1/v2c)
A single listener on the standard trap port, accepting any SNMPv1/v2c community. listen is required: without an endpoint the job binds nothing. Restrict the allowlist for production.
jobs:
- name: local
listen:
endpoints:
- protocol: udp
address: 0.0.0.0
port: 162
versions:
- v1
- v2c
